Job Summary:
Title: Artist Management Intern (Paid)
Location: Los Angeles, CA (In-office, 5 days a week)
Average hours: Up to 30 hours per week
The Role:
Roc Nation is looking for a dedicated and organized Talent Management Intern to join us in the Los Angeles office this Fall. This internship will allow students to gain first-hand, experience in a variety of areas, including but not limited to: talent management, operations and administration.
Areas that you will be learning about:
Understanding best practices involved with managing Artist day to day schedule
Prioritizing deliverables, managing project timelines and deadlines
How to manage email accounts for clients and management team, vetting inquiries and fielding them appropriately
How to organize and maintain an artist calendar of deadlines, meetings, and appointments
This position includes working with high-profile individuals, so understanding personal and professional boundaries, as well as confidentiality and professionalism is a must
Qualifications:
Must be able to work out of LA office for the Fall semester
Must be currently enrolled as a full-time college student working towards your Associate’s, Bachelor’s or Masters degree or recent graduate
Working knowledge of Microsoft Office (Word, Excel), Google Suite and Keynote
Candidates pursuing a degree in Marketing, Communications, or Music/Entertainment/Sports preferred
Excellent written, oral and interpersonal skills
Works well in a dynamic, collaborative team environment
Works well with tight & strict deadlines
Easily adjusts to shifting priorities
Trustworthy with sensitive information
